Company Description

SGS Australia is a leading provider of Testing, Inspection, and Certification services, supporting multiple industries across the country with trusted expertise and technical excellence. Backed by SGS’s global legacy of over 140 years, we operate one of the largest networks of accredited laboratories and field facilities in Australia, with a network of more than 50 offices and laboratories and over 1,600 employees across Australia. We are accredited by NATA and ISO 9001, ensuring our services meet both Australian and international standards.

Job Description

SGS is seeking a detail-oriented and proactive Payroll Administrator to join our team based in Perth. This role is key in ensuring the accurate and timely processing of employee data and payroll transactions across our systems. The ideal candidate will have experience working with HR and payroll platforms, excellent communication skills, and a commitment to confidentiality and compliance.

What you’ll be doing

  • Entering new employee information into Workday and Ascender accurately and on time.
  • Processing employee job changes and terminations across payroll systems.
  • Responding to payroll enquiries through the shared inbox in a professional and timely manner.
  • Extracting employee payslips from Ascender ESS when required.
  • Maintaining accurate employee records while handling confidential information with discretion.
  • Working in line with SGS policies, procedures, safety standards and Code of Integrity.

Qualifications

The successful candidate will have:

  • Previous administration experience, ideally within payroll, HR or a high-volume data entry environment
  • Highly organised, efficient and comfortable working with sensitive information
  • High level of accuracy and attention to detail.
  • Excellent written and verbal communication skills.
  • Intermediate Excel skills and the ability to communicate clearly with internal stakeholders will help you succeed in this role.
